linux用host查ip地址的命令
-
Linux中查看IP地址的命令有很多,其中使用`host`命令是一种常用的方法。使用`host`命令可以查找指定主机名的IP地址。
要使用`host`命令查看IP地址,只需在终端中输入以下命令:
“`
host [主机名]
“`其中 `[主机名]`是要查询的主机名或域名。执行该命令后,系统将返回主机名对应的IP地址信息。
以下是一个示例:
“`
$ host http://www.example.com
“`执行该命令后,系统将返回类似以下的结果:
“`
http://www.example.com has address 93.184.216.34
http://www.example.com has IPv6 address 2606:2800:220:1:248:1893:25c8:1946
“`在这个例子中,`www.example.com`的IP地址为 `93.184.216.34` 和 `2606:2800:220:1:248:1893:25c8:1946`。
需要注意的是,`host`命令需要联网才能正常工作。如果无法正常联网或者输入的主机名不正确,`host`命令将无法返回IP地址。
除了`host`命令,Linux还有一些其他常用的命令可以用于查看IP地址,如`ifconfig`命令和`ip`命令。这些命令可以提供更详细的网络配置信息。
2年前 -
在Linux中,可以使用`host`命令来查找IP地址。`host`是一个用于DNS查询的命令行工具,它可以通过域名查询IP地址以及域名的其他相关信息。
以下是使用`host`命令查找IP地址的方法及其选项:
1. 基本语法: `host
`
只需将``替换为要查询的域名,命令将返回与该域名相关的IP地址。 2. 可选项:
– `-a`:显示详细的查询结果,包括记录类型和TTL(生存时间)。
– `-c`:指定要查询的记录类型,如A(IPv4地址)、AAAA(IPv6地址)、MX(邮件交换器)等,默认为A记录类型。
– `-t`:同`-c`选项,用于指定要查询的记录类型。
– `-4`:仅返回IPv4地址。
– `-6`:仅返回IPv6地址。
– `-W`:设置查询超时时间。 以下是一些示例用法:
1. 查询域名的IPv4地址:
“`
host example.com
“`2. 查询域名的IPv6地址:
“`
host -t AAAA example.com
“`3. 查询域名的MX记录:
“`
host -t MX example.com
“`4. 查询域名的所有记录类型:
“`
host -a example.com
“`5. 查询域名的IPv4地址,并设置查询超时时间为5秒:
“`
host -4 -W 5 example.com
“`请注意,要运行`host`命令,您的系统必须安装有`bind-utils`软件包。
2年前 -
在Linux系统中,可以使用host命令来查找IP地址和域名解析。host命令是一个常用的网络工具,在终端中使用非常简单。下面将详细介绍host命令的使用方法和操作流程。
第一步:打开终端
在Linux系统中,可以通过点击桌面上的终端图标或者使用快捷键组合Ctrl+Alt+T来打开终端。第二步:输入host命令
在终端中输入以下命令格式来使用host命令:host [选项] [域名/IP地址]下面是一些常用选项:
-4:强制使用IPv4地址进行解析
-6:强制使用IPv6地址进行解析
-t <类型>:指定解析的记录类型,常用的有A、AAAA、MX、NS等例如,要查找域名www.example.com的IP地址,可以使用以下命令:host http://www.example.com
第三步:解析结果输出
在终端中执行host命令后,会立即显示域名的IP地址或错误信息。如果域名解析成功,将输出一个或多个IP地址,如果域名解析失败,将输出相关错误信息。host命令的输出结果通常由以下几部分组成:
域名:指定的域名或IP地址
IP地址:解析出的IP地址
记录类型:解析使用的记录类型
TTL:解析结果的生存时间
NS记录:域名的NS记录
解析结果示例:http://www.example.com has address 93.184.216.34
http://www.example.com has IPv6 address 2606:2800:220:1:248:1893:25c8:1946第四步:使用选项进行高级操作
host命令还支持一些选项进行高级操作。例如,使用-t选项指定解析类型为MX来查找邮件服务器的IP地址:host -t MX example.com
除了MX记录,还可以通过使用其他记录类型来查找其他信息,如NS记录和CNAME记录。
host命令也可以通过指定IPv4或IPv6地址来查找相应的域名。例如,要查找IP地址为93.184.216.34的域名,可以使用以下命令:host 93.184.216.34
总结:通过host命令,可以方便快速地进行域名解析和IP地址查询。无论是在个人使用中还是在网络管理中,host命令都是一个非常实用的工具。
2年前